当前位置 : 145z游戏站 | 传奇世界 | 技术教程 | 

更新时遇到错误怎么解决?全场景修复攻略与实用技巧汇总

热度:
不管是软件、游戏还是系统更新,常遇到进度卡住、报错闪退、更新后无法使用等问题。这些错误多因网络中断、文件损坏、空间不足或程序冲突导致,无需反复重试,按以下步骤精准排查,能高效解决更新问题。
一、先定错误类型:常见更新错误及针对性修复
不同更新错误对应不同解决方向,先根据现象匹配错误类型,再动手操作更高效:
1. 更新卡住:进度条不动 / 长时间无响应
现象:点击更新后进度条卡在某百分比(如 30%、80%),等待半小时仍无变化,或提示 “正在准备更新” 却无进度。
修复步骤:
① 先强制结束更新进程:按 “Ctrl+Shift+Esc” 打开任务管理器,在 “进程” 栏找到更新相关程序(如 “软件更新程序”“Windows Update”“游戏更新客户端”),右键 “结束任务”,避免后台进程占用资源;
② 清理更新缓存:若为系统更新,按 “Win+R” 输入 “% windir%\SoftwareDistribution\Download”,删除文件夹内所有文件(无需删除文件夹本身);若为软件 / 游戏更新,找到对应安装目录下的 “Update” 或 “Temp” 文件夹,删除里面的缓存文件;
③ 重启后重新更新:重启电脑(或软件),关闭后台下载工具、视频软件,确保网络和系统资源集中用于更新,避免再次卡住。
2. 更新失败:提示 “文件错误”“安装包损坏”
现象:更新到某阶段弹出 “文件损坏请重新下载”“安装包校验失败”,或更新完成后提示 “更新错误代码 XXX”(如 0x80070005、-2001)。
修复步骤:
① 验证安装包完整性:若为手动下载的更新包,在下载页面找到 “校验码”(如 MD5、SHA256),用校验工具(如 HashTab)对比本地文件校验码,不一致则说明安装包损坏,需从官网重新下载(避免第三方平台,防止文件被篡改);
② 修复本地文件:若为软件 / 游戏更新,打开软件设置,找到 “修复” 或 “验证文件完整性” 功能(如游戏客户端的 “验证游戏文件” 按钮),程序会自动检测并下载缺失 / 损坏的文件;
③ 换网络重新下载:若多次下载仍提示文件错误,切换网络(如 WiFi 换有线、手机热点),避免网络丢包导致安装包下载不完整,下载时不要暂停,确保一次性完成。
3. 更新后报错:程序打不开 / 功能异常
现象:更新完成后点击程序无反应,或打开后弹出 “缺失 XXX.dll”“程序已损坏”,甚至出现闪退、卡顿。
修复步骤:
① 回滚到旧版本:打开软件设置,找到 “版本历史” 或 “更新管理”,选择 “回退到上一版本”(部分软件支持此功能);若为系统更新,进入 “控制面板→程序→查看已安装的更新”,右键最近安装的更新包,选择 “卸载”,重启电脑后恢复旧版;
② 修复缺失组件:若提示缺失.dll 文件,在搜索引擎输入文件名(如 “msvcp140.dll 缺失”),从微软官网下载对应版本的 Visual C++ 运行库(32 位 / 64 位需与程序匹配),安装后重启程序;
③ 检查兼容性:右键程序图标→“属性→兼容性”,勾选 “以兼容模式运行此程序”(如选择 “Windows 7”,针对旧版软件),同时勾选 “以管理员身份运行”,避免权限不足导致功能异常。
4. 更新中断:提示 “空间不足”“权限不够”
现象:更新过程中突然中断,弹出 “磁盘空间不足无法继续” 或 “没有足够权限执行更新”。
修复步骤:
① 清理磁盘空间:打开 “此电脑”,右键更新所在磁盘(多为 C 盘)→“属性→磁盘清理”,勾选 “临时文件”“下载文件”“回收站” 等,点击 “确定” 删除;若空间仍不足,转移磁盘内的大文件(如视频、安装包)到其他分区,确保更新分区至少有 10GB 空闲空间;
② 获取管理员权限:右键更新程序→“以管理员身份运行”,若为系统更新,确保当前登录账户为管理员账户(进入 “设置→账户→家庭和其他用户”,查看账户类型是否为 “管理员”);若为软件更新,关闭正在使用该软件的其他进程,避免文件被占用导致权限不足。
二、通用解决技巧:不管什么更新错误都能用
遇到不确定类型的更新错误,先尝试以下通用方法,80% 的问题能快速解决:
1. 基础排查:重启 + 网络重置
① 重启设备:不管是电脑、手机还是软件,重启能清除临时故障(如内存占用、进程冲突),重启后优先尝试重新更新;
② 重置网络:若怀疑网络问题,电脑端按 “Win+R” 输入 “ncpa.cpl”,右键当前网络(WiFi / 以太网)→“禁用”,等待 10 秒后重新 “启用”;或手机端关闭 WiFi 再打开,确保网络连接稳定(可通过测速工具确认网速,更新时建议网速不低于 1Mbps)。
2. 解除程序冲突:关闭后台干扰
① 关闭防护程序:临时关闭杀毒软件、电脑管家的实时防护功能(更新完成后需重新开启),避免其误判更新文件为 “异常文件” 并拦截;
② 结束占用进程:在任务管理器 “详细信息” 栏,找到与更新程序相关的后台进程(如 “UpdateService.exe”),或占用大量 CPU / 内存的进程(如视频渲染、大型游戏),右键 “结束任务”,释放系统资源。
3. 系统级修复:修复系统文件 / 注册表
① 修复系统文件:电脑端按 “Win+X” 选择 “Windows PowerShell(管理员)”,输入 “sfc /scannow” 并回车,等待系统扫描并修复损坏的系统文件(适用于系统更新错误,或软件更新受系统文件影响的情况);
② 清理无效注册表:若更新错误反复出现,可使用系统自带工具或可靠的注册表清理软件(如 CCleaner),扫描并删除与旧版程序、失效更新相关的注册表项(操作前建议备份注册表,避免误删关键项)。
三、预防更新错误:提前做好这些,减少麻烦
与其出现错误后修复,不如提前预防,这些技巧能大幅降低更新出错概率:
1. 更新前准备:检查 + 备份
① 检查基础条件:更新前确认网络稳定(避免在网络高峰期更新)、磁盘空间充足(预留至少更新文件 2 倍的空闲空间)、设备电量充足(电脑需插电,手机电量不低于 50%,防止更新中断电);
② 备份重要数据:若为系统或关键软件更新,提前备份文件(如文档、软件配置),避免更新失败导致数据丢失(可复制到 U 盘或云盘,简单高效)。
2. 选择更新时机与渠道
① 避开高峰时段:系统更新、热门软件更新高峰期(如节假日、工作日早 9 点),服务器压力大易导致下载缓慢或文件出错,建议选择夜间或凌晨更新;
② 从官方渠道更新:不管是系统、软件还是游戏,优先通过官方客户端、官网下载更新包,避免第三方平台的修改版更新包(可能含错误文件或多余插件)。
3. 定期维护设备:减少潜在隐患
① 定期清理缓存:每月清理一次系统临时文件、软件更新缓存,避免冗余文件堆积导致更新冲突;
② 更新基础组件:定期更新显卡驱动、声卡驱动、Visual C++ 运行库等基础组件(从硬件官网或微软官网下载),确保这些组件与新更新的程序兼容。
更新错误看似杂乱,实则遵循 “先定错误类型→基础修复→进阶排查→预防加固” 的逻辑就能解决。遇到错误时不要盲目重试或卸载重装,先记录错误提示(如代码、弹窗内容),再对应上述方法操作,效率会更高。多数情况下,简单的缓存清理、权限设置或网络重置,就能让更新正常完成。
[顶部]